Amid China’s storm, Hong Kong holds fast to its umbrella GlobeDebate

Taiwanese supporters show slogans and yellow umbrellas to support for the nine Hong Kong leaders of 2014 pro-democracy protests, in Taipei, Taiwan, Wednesday, April 24, 2019. A court in Hong Kong is preparing Wednesday to sentence the nine leaders after they were convicted last month of public nuisance offenses. Following the verdict for the Umbrella Movement leaders, Hong Kong stayed quiet. But the fact that people have not returned to the streets does not mean they no longer care.

This consciousness has nourished an ever stronger Hong Kong identity. Many people, particularly young people, are affirming their identity as Hong Kongers, partly by increasingly expressing interest in anything “local.” Bookstores have been prominently displaying books about Hong Kong history, many written by Hong Kong people.
